Liberia was founded by freed slaves from the United States and uses the US dollar as official currency alongside the Liberian dollar. With a weak economy and high dependence on iron and rubber exports, crypto adoption is very low.

Liberia uses the US dollar as official currency, reducing the need for USDT as a hedge. Crypto adoption is very low but could grow with improved internet access.
Very limited adoption with no regulatory changes.
Liberia has no cryptocurrency regulation. The Central Bank of Liberia has not issued guidelines. The use of USD as official currency reduces the need for USDT as a store of value, but informal adoption is growing for remittances.
